What are electrolytes?
Electrolytes are substances that dissolve in water and form charged particles that the body needs to enable essential bodily functions. The most important electrolytes include sodium, potassium, calcium, magnesium, and chloride, which, among other things, regulate the fluid balance.

Electrolyte Powder - Zero Sugar
Flavor: Lemon Orange
Ingredients: Acidifier (citric acid), trisodium citrate dihydrate, inulin, trimagnesium dicitrate, natural flavoring, potassium chloride, tripotassium citrate, taurine, steviol glycosides from stevia, salt, coloring food (safflower), L-ascorbic acid, thiamine mononitrate
Average nutritional values1:
| per 100 g powder | per serving (8 g in 300 ml) | *%NRV | |
| Energy | 711 kJ / 166 kcal | 57 kJ / 13 kcal | |
| Fat | 0 g | 0 g | |
| of which saturated fatty acids | 0 g | 0 g | |
| Carbohydrates | 7.2 g | 0.6 g | |
| of which sugars | 3.3 g | 0 g | |
| Fiber | 14 g | 1.1 g | |
| Protein | 1.3 g | < 0.5 g | |
| Salt2 | 14.7 g | 1.2 g | |
| Vitamin C | 500 mg | 40 mg | 50 |
| Thiamine | 6.9 mg | 0.55 mg | 50 |
| Potassium | 3750 mg | 300 mg | 15 |
| Chloride | 2640 mg | 211 mg | 26 |
| Magnesium | 1500 mg | 120 mg | 32 |
| Sodium | 5899.8 mg | 472 mg | |
| Taurine | 1875 mg | 150 mg |
*Percentage of Nutrient Reference Values according to Regulation (EU) No. 1169/2011
1The nutrient content of raw materials is subject to natural variations.
2The salt content is exclusively due to the presence of naturally occurring sodium.

In our electrolyte powder, we specifically include the minerals that are particularly important when fluids are lost through exercise or sweating – such as sodium, potassium, and magnesium. Calcium is usually obtained in sufficient amounts through diet. Additionally, a powder without calcium is often more soluble and easier to digest.
Electrolytes are flushed out of the body through heavy sweating or other significant fluid loss. This powder is therefore ideal for intense workouts, hot summer temperatures, or physical activities that lead to increased fluid loss.
If you know you're about to engage in sweaty, intense exercise, it's best to consume the electrolyte powder during your workout to immediately replenish lost fluids and electrolytes.
When used as normal and in accordance with the recommended dosage, side effects are generally not expected. However, consuming too much can lead to an imbalance, so you should always follow the dosage recommendations.
You can take the electrolyte powder as needed, for example, if you exercise regularly or are exposed to extreme heat. For everyday use, there’s no need to take it regularly as long as you eat a balanced and varied diet.

nutri+ Taurine powder Taurine is an organic compound produced in the body by the breakdown of the amino acids cysteine and methionine and is often incorrectly labelled as an amino acid. It is found throughout the body, with particularly high concentrations found in muscles, leucocytes and the brain. Whilst taurine has long been considered non-essential as the body produces it itself, the amount produced is often only sufficient for basic organic functions. As taurine is mainly found in animal foods such as meat, fish, seafood, eggs and dairy products, supplementation is particularly recommended for vegans and vegetarians. Calcium + vitamin D Calcium is the main component of our bones. In the event of a deficiency (as can occur during heavy sweating, for example), the body draws on its own reserves - the bones. This can lead to bone fragility. Particularly in the cold season, the body's own production of vitamin D is often insufficient. Magnesium Without magnesium, the body would not be able to move a single muscle. It is essential for muscle contraction and an important component of our bones. Magnesium is excreted through sweat, which can lead to muscle cramps during sporting activity. Athletes must therefore always ensure they have a sufficient intake of magnesium. Vitamin E Vitamin E (tocopherols) is an essential nutrient that the body cannot produce itself. It protects unsaturated fatty acids in cell walls from attacks by free radicals. Additional free radicals are produced during sporting activity. Athletes must therefore ensure that they take an additional supply of vitamin E. Vitamin C Vitamin C is a natural, essential antioxidant that scavenges free radicals and renders them harmless. It is particularly effective in combination with vitamin E. As the increased metabolic turnover during sporting activity produces more free radicals, athletes must ensure that they consume sufficient vitamin C. Iron Iron is responsible for the formation of red blood cells and - as a component of haemoglobin - for the transport of oxygen.
